Frequently Asked Questions
What is the maximum clock frequency of the PIC12F675-E/SNG and how does supply voltage affect it?
The PIC12F675-E/SNG runs at up to 20 MHz when powered at 4.5 V to 5.5 V. At lower supply voltages it still operates reliably: at 3 V the maximum clock is 10 MHz, and at 2 V minimum supply the device is rated for 4 MHz operation. This voltage-frequency scaling allows designers to trade off processing speed against battery life in power-sensitive applications.
How many ADC channels does the PIC12F675-E/SNG provide and what is their resolution?
The PIC12F675-E/SNG includes a 10-bit successive-approximation ADC with 4 multiplexed input channels. The 10-bit resolution yields 1,024 quantization levels, corresponding to approximately 4.88 mV per step at a 5 V reference. This is sufficient for reading NTC thermistors, light sensors, potentiometers, and other analog transducers directly without an external ADC.
